Я не могу создать пользователя в Artifactory через REST API.
Документ, который я использую: https://www.jfrog.com/confluence/display/RTF/Artifactory+REST+API#ArtifactoryRESTAPI-CreateorReplaceUser
мой оставшийся звонок:
curl -k -u user:pass -X PUT -H "Content-Type: application/json" "$API_URL/security/user/$USERNAME" -t $BUILD_ID.json
содержимое $BUILD_ID.json:
{"name" : "test","password" : "password","groups" : ["test","Test_AJU_group"]}
но, к сожалению, все еще получаю ошибку http 400 - неверный запрос.
14:57:12 {
14:57:12 "errors" : [ {
14:57:12 "status" : 400,
14:57:12 "message" : "Bad Request"
14:57:12 } ]
14:57:12 }Finished: SUCCESS
Я попытался отправить данные в URL вместо файла с теми же результатами.
Возможно /security/user
=> /security/users
?
спасибо, хоть кто-то может читать, а я нет. Мне помог этот! :)
после помощи Джейсона та же команда только что исправила опечатку, я получаю: 09:44:45 «сообщение»: «Нет содержимого для сопоставления с объектом из-за окончания ввода», насколько я понимаю, клиент не завершает http-соединение после данных Отправить. Может кто-нибудь помочь мне решить эту проблему, пожалуйста?